Curtis is Central 214’s new summer host, but he prefers to call himself a “Spacial Arrangement Coodinator,” because he thinks it sounds much more dignified than “Door Whore.”

Born in Chicago and raised in Garland, Texas, Curtis attended Southern Methodist University, earning a degree in advertising with a minor in corporate communications and public affairs. Working at Central 214 is the perfect summer job while he contemplates law school and starting a company with his best friend, Amanda.

Outside work, Curtis spends his time being a karaoke all-star, and lately, being mistaken for American Idol’s Adam Lambert. Admittedly obsessed with his appearance, Curtis will do whatever it takes to look good and young and never age. He is a former tennis instructor with the calves to prove it, and enjoys running and rollerblading with his dog, Chance.

The sarcastic, social, competitive flirt says there are two things he absolutely cannot
live without: Tex Mex and margaritas.
